Role Overview
We are seeking a dedicated and detail-oriented Care Coordinator to join our dynamic healthcare team. In this role, you will be pivotal in ensuring seamless communication between patients, healthcare providers, and support services to optimize patient care and outcomes. You will leverage your organizational skills and healthcare knowledge to facilitate care plans, improve patient engagement, and enhance the overall patient experience.
Responsibilities
- Develop and manage individualized care plans for patients, ensuring alignment with their health goals and needs
- Coordinate communication between patients, families, and multidisciplinary teams to facilitate comprehensive care
- Monitor and document patient progress, adjusting care plans as necessary to achieve optimal outcomes
- Educate patients and families about care processes, treatment options, and available resources
- Identify barriers to care and work collaboratively with patients and providers to develop solutions
- Assist in scheduling appointments, follow-ups, and necessary referrals to specialists
- Utilize electronic health records (EHR) to maintain accurate patient information and documentation
Required Qualifications
- Bachelor's degree in Nursing, Social Work, Public Health, or a related field
- 2+ years of experience in care coordination, patient advocacy, or healthcare administration
- Strong understanding of healthcare systems, insurance processes, and community resources
- Excellent communication and interpersonal skills, with the ability to build rapport with diverse patient populations
- Proficiency in using electronic health record systems and other relevant software
Preferred Qualifications
- Experience in a clinical setting or direct patient care
- Certification in care coordination or case management (e.g., CCM, CMC) is a plus
- Familiarity with population health management and quality improvement initiatives
- Knowledge of regulatory requirements and best practices in patient care coordination
